What Are the Requirements to be Admitted to the Program?

First-time freshmen who wish to major in Biomedical Sciences must:

  • Achieve a Math ACT score of 23 or higher
  • Achieve an English ACT score of 20 or higher
  • Earn a high school GPA of 3.0 or better

Students transferring to EKU who wish to major in Biomedical Sciences must:

  • Carry a GPA of 3.0 on at least 24 hours attempted

EKU students wishing change majors to Biomedical Sciences must:

  • Carry a GPA of 3.0 on at least 24 hours attempted

Where Are Recent Graduates Employed?

  • Recent EKU Biomedical Sciences graduates are pursuing graduate and professional degrees.
  • Doctor of Medicine/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ine at University of Kentucky, University of Louisville, Uniform Services, and University of Pikeville
  • Doctor of Dental Surgery/Doctor of Medical Dentistry at University of Kentucky and University of Louisville
  • Doctor of Veterinary Medicine at Auburn University
  • Doctor of Optometry at Indiana University, Southern University, and University of Alabama
  • Doctor of Physical Therapy at Marshall University
  • Doctor of Pharmacy at University of Kentucky
  • MS in Physician Assistant at University of Kentucky
  • PhD in Biomedical Science at University of Kentucky

Are There Scholarship Opportunities?

The Department of Biological Sciences has a few scholarships for continuing sophomores, juniors, and seiors based on academic performance within the department and need. Applications are accepted each spring semester following the posting of the application information on our department webpage. New students may find opportunities through the EKU Financial Aid Office or the College of Science.
